Datavant is the data collaboration platform trusted for healthcare. Guided by our mission to make the world’s health data secure, accessible and actionable, we provide critical data solutions for organizations across the healthcare ecosystem - including providers, health plans, researchers, and life sciences companies. From fulfilling a single patient’s request for their medical records to powering the AI revolution in healthcare, Datavanters are building the future of how data is connected and used to improve health. By joining Datavant today, you’re stepping onto a driven and highly collaborative team that is passionate about creating transformative change in healthcare. What We’re Looking For We are seeking a deeply experienced Salesforce Solutions Architect to join the Salesforce Engineering team at Datavant, serving as the primary bridge between business stakeholders and our technical delivery teams. You will be joining an emerging, high-impact Center of Excellence focused on spearheading key digital transformation initiatives with the goal of implementing multiple Salesforce products at an enterprise level. You will be responsible for translating complex business requirements into scalable, well-designed Salesforce solutions while ensuring every initiative is aligned to business outcomes, platform best practices, and long-term architectural integrity. This is a unique opportunity to shape the solution vision for company-wide Salesforce investments and lay the strategic foundation for years to come. What You Will Do Serve as the trusted technical advisor across business, product, and engineering, ensuring proposed solutions are feasible, scalable, and grounded in platform capabilities and long-term architectural direction. Own and enforce enterprise-level solution standards, technical architecture governance, and best practices across multiple production instances.
